MIO OVERVIEW

The Marketing Investment Optimization (MIO) vertical at Amgen is responsible for enabling data-driven, decision-grade marketing investment decisions across brands, channels, and portfolios.

MIO brings together Investment Analytics, Digital Analytics, and Marketing Science Operations (MSO) to deliver reliable measurement, performance insights, and decision support that optimize marketing investments.

The Digital Analytics team focuses on media measurement (paid and owned media), campaign analytics, performance goal setting, web analytics and short-term optimizations. The team partners closely with Brand Marketing, Agencies, Media Strategists, Operations and other cross functional analytics groups to translate complex performance data into clear, actionable recommendations.

Amgen harnesses the best of biology and technology to fight the world’s toughest diseases, and make people’s lives easier, fuller and longer. We helped establish the biotechnology industry, and we remain on the cutting-edge of innovation, using technology and human genetic data to push beyond what’s known today. Our investment in research and development has yielded a robust pipeline that builds on our existing portfolio of medicines to treat cancer, heart disease, osteoporosis, inflammatory diseases and rare diseases.

Amgen is one of 30 companies comprising the Dow Jones Industrial Average®, and part of the Nasdaq-100 Index®. In 2024, Amgen was named one of the “World’s Most Innovative Companies” by Fast Company and one of “America’s Best Large Employers” by Forbes.
